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
H
hp-smart
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
platform
hp-smart
Commits
0150172e
Commit
0150172e
authored
Mar 30, 2024
by
liuyang
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
2024-03-29 企业log优化
parent
4a80baf1
Show whitespace changes
Inline
Side-by-side
Showing
4 changed files
with
70 additions
and
69 deletions
+70
-69
iPlatV7-index.js
src/main/resources/META-INF/resources/iPlatV7-index.js
+17
-4
iPlatV7-index.jsp
src/main/resources/META-INF/resources/iPlatV7-index.jsp
+2
-2
HPPZ009.js
src/main/webapp/HP/PZ/HPPZ009.js
+39
-55
HPPZ009.jsp
src/main/webapp/HP/PZ/HPPZ009.jsp
+12
-8
No files found.
src/main/resources/META-INF/resources/iPlatV7-index.js
View file @
0150172e
...
...
@@ -2443,20 +2443,33 @@ $(function () {
}
});
}
try
{
if
(
loginName
!==
"admin"
){
var
info
=
new
EiInfo
()
info
.
set
(
"inqu_status-0-companyCode"
,
loginName
)
EiCommunicator
.
send
(
"HPPZ009"
,
"query"
,
info
,
{
onSuccess
:
function
(
ei
)
{
//返回结果集
if
(
ei
.
blocks
.
result
!==
undefined
){
let
results
=
ei
.
getBlock
(
"result"
).
getMappedRows
()
$
(
"#sidebar img"
).
attr
(
"src"
,
downloadHref
(
results
[
0
].
docIdPc
,
results
[
0
].
projectEnv
));
let
results
=
ei
.
getBlock
(
"result"
).
getMappedRows
();
if
(
results
.
length
>
0
&&
results
[
0
].
docIdPc
.
length
>
0
){
let
src
=
downloadHref
(
results
[
0
].
docIdPc
,
results
[
0
].
projectEnv
)
let
img
=
`<img src="
${
src
}
" style='width:200px;height:55px;background-image: none;'/>`
;
$
(
"#sidebar .sidebar-content .side-header"
).
html
(
img
);
//$("#sidebar .sidebar-content .side-header").attr("src",downloadHref(results[0].docIdPc,results[0].projectEnv));
}
else
{
$
(
"#sidebar .sidebar-content .side-header"
).
html
(
"<span class=
\"
logo
\"
></span>"
);
}
}
else
{
$
(
"#sidebar .sidebar-content .side-header"
).
html
(
"<span class=
\"
logo
\"
></span>"
);
}
},
onFail
:
function
(
ei
)
{
}
},
{
async
:
false
});
}
else
{
$
(
"#sidebar .sidebar-content .side-header"
).
html
(
"<span class=
\"
logo
\"
></span>"
);
}
}
catch
(
error
)
{
$
(
"#sidebar .sidebar-content .side-header"
).
html
(
"<span class=
\"
logo
\"
></span>"
);
}
})
...
...
src/main/resources/META-INF/resources/iPlatV7-index.jsp
View file @
0150172e
...
...
@@ -186,8 +186,8 @@
<div
class=
"sidebar-content"
>
<!-- Side Header -->
<div
class=
"side-header"
>
<img
src=
"${ctx}/hpjx-logo.png"
style=
"width:200px;height:55px;background-image: none;"
/
>
<
%
--
<
span
class=
"logo"
></span>
--%>
<
%
--
<
img
src=
"${ctx}/hpjx-logo.png"
style=
"width:200px;height:55px;background-image: none;"
/>
--%
>
<
%
--
<
span
class=
"logo"
></span>
--%>
<
%
--
<
span
class=
"projectType"
>
[
<
%=
projectTypeDesc
%
>
]
</span>
--%>
</div>
<!-- END Side Header -->
...
...
src/main/webapp/HP/PZ/HPPZ009.js
View file @
0150172e
...
...
@@ -10,17 +10,20 @@ $(function () {
}
},
onAdd
:
function
(
e
)
{
e
.
preventDefault
()
$
(
"#type"
).
val
(
"update"
)
$
(
"#companyName"
).
val
();
$
(
"#loginPrefix"
).
val
();
$
(
"#validFlag"
).
val
();
$
(
"#PCfileDocId"
).
val
();
$
(
"#APPfileDocId"
).
val
();
$
(
"#remark"
).
val
();
$
(
"#id"
).
val
();
$
(
"#companyCode"
).
val
();
addCompany
(
$
(
"#insertGroup"
))
e
.
preventDefault
();
$
(
"#type"
).
val
(
"insert"
)
$
(
"#companyName"
).
val
(
""
);
$
(
"#loginPrefix"
).
val
(
""
);
$
(
"#validFlag"
).
val
(
1
);
$
(
"#PCfileDocId"
).
val
(
""
);
$
(
"#APPfileDocId"
).
val
(
""
);
$
(
"#remark"
).
val
(
""
);
$
(
"#id"
).
val
(
""
);
$
(
"#companyCode"
).
val
(
""
);
$
(
"#insertGroup_wnd_title"
).
text
(
"新增企业管理"
);
clealImgLabel
(
$
(
"#app-img"
));
clealImgLabel
(
$
(
"#pc-img"
));
addCompany
(
$
(
"#insertGroup"
));
},
onSave
:
function
(
e
)
{
// 阻止后台保存请求,使用自定义保存
...
...
@@ -41,6 +44,8 @@ $(function () {
* e.tr tr, jquery
*/
onRowClick
:
function
(
e
)
{
let
app
=
$
(
"#app-img"
),
pc
=
$
(
"#pc-img"
);
$
(
"#type"
).
val
(
"update"
);
$
(
"#companyCode"
).
val
(
e
.
model
.
companyCode
);
$
(
"#companyName"
).
val
(
e
.
model
.
companyName
);
...
...
@@ -50,7 +55,10 @@ $(function () {
$
(
"#APPfileDocId"
).
val
(
e
.
model
.
docIdApp
);
$
(
"#remark"
).
val
(
e
.
model
.
remark
);
$
(
"#id"
).
val
(
e
.
model
.
id
);
addCompany
(
$
(
"#insertGroup"
))
addImgLabel
(
app
,
e
.
model
.
docIdApp
);
addImgLabel
(
pc
,
e
.
model
.
docIdPc
);
$
(
"#insertGroup_wnd_title"
).
text
(
"修改企业管理"
);
addCompany
(
$
(
"#insertGroup"
));
/*WindowUtil({
"title": "",
"content": "<div class='kendo-del-message'>" + e.row + "</div>"
...
...
@@ -66,7 +74,6 @@ $(function () {
// 删除
$
(
"#BTN_DELETE"
).
on
(
"click"
,
deleteFunc
);
IPLATUI
.
EFUpload
=
{
docIdApp
:
{
showFileList
:
false
,
...
...
@@ -85,13 +92,9 @@ $(function () {
return
;
}
$
(
"#APPfileDocId"
).
val
(
docId
);
addImgLabel
(
$
(
"#app-img"
),
docId
);
//$("#app-img").attr("src",downloadHref(docId));
NotificationUtil
(
"附件上传成功"
);
//console.log($("#fileDocId").val())
//saveTemp(e);
/*try {
parent.JSColorbox.setValueCallback(e);
} catch (e){
}*/
},
},
docIdPc
:
{
...
...
@@ -111,13 +114,9 @@ $(function () {
return
;
}
$
(
"#PCfileDocId"
).
val
(
docId
);
addImgLabel
(
$
(
"#pc-img"
),
docId
);
/*$("#pc-img").attr("src",downloadHref(docId));*/
NotificationUtil
(
"附件上传成功"
);
//console.log($("#fileDocId").val())
//saveTemp(e);
/*try {
parent.JSColorbox.setValueCallback(e);
} catch (e){
}*/
},
}
};
...
...
@@ -269,36 +268,21 @@ $("#update").click(function () {
*/
function
addCompanyCallback
(
e
)
{
resultGrid
.
dataSource
.
page
(
1
);
/*let result = new EiInfo();
let docId = e.response.docId;
let docName = e.response.docName;
let docSize = e.response.docSize;
let docTag = e.response.docTag;
let docUrl = e.response.docUrl;
result.set("result-0-docId",docId);
result.set("result-0-docName",docName);
result.set("result-0-docSize",docSize);
result.set("result-0-docTag",docTag);
result.set("result-0-realPath",docUrl);
EiCommunicator.send("HPXS003", "insert", result, {
onSuccess: function (ei) {
if (ei.getStatus() >= 0) {
if (ei.getStatus() == 0) {
NotificationUtil(ei, 'warning');
} else {
NotificationUtil(ei);
}
} else {
NotificationUtil(ei, "error");
}
resultGrid.dataSource.page(1);
},
onFail: function (ei) {
// 发生异常
NotificationUtil("执行失败,原因[" + ei + "]", "error");
}
function
addImgLabel
(
id
,
docId
)
{
clealImgLabel
(
id
);
if
(
isBlank
(
docId
)){
return
;
}
}, {
async: false
});*/
let
src
=
downloadHref
(
docId
)
let
img
=
`<img src="
${
src
}
" style='width:200px;height:55px;background-image: none;'/>`
;
id
.
html
(
img
);
}
function
clealImgLabel
(
id
)
{
id
.
html
(
""
);
}
src/main/webapp/HP/PZ/HPPZ009.jsp
View file @
0150172e
...
...
@@ -13,7 +13,7 @@
</EF:EFRegion>
<EF:EFRegion
id=
"result"
title=
"记录集"
>
<EF:EFGrid
blockId=
"result"
autoDraw=
"override"
checkMode=
"
row
"
>
<EF:EFGrid
blockId=
"result"
autoDraw=
"override"
checkMode=
"
single
"
>
<EF:EFColumn
ename=
"id"
cname=
"主键"
hidden=
"true"
/>
<EF:EFColumn
ename=
"docIdPc"
cname=
"主键"
hidden=
"true"
/>
<EF:EFColumn
ename=
"docIdApp"
cname=
"主键"
hidden=
"true"
/>
...
...
@@ -35,18 +35,18 @@
<span
style=
'color: red;font-size: 13px;'
>
说明:新增企业时会同步新增企业管理员账户,账号和密码与企业编码相同
</span>
</EF:EFRegion>
<EF:EFWindow
id=
"insertGroup"
t
op=
"100px"
left=
"280px"
width=
"38
%"
height=
"70%"
>
<EF:EFWindow
id=
"insertGroup"
t
itle=
"企业管理"
top=
"100px"
left=
"280px"
width=
"40
%"
height=
"70%"
>
<form>
<div
class=
"form-group row"
>
<label
for=
"companyName"
class=
"col-sm-2 col-form-label col-form-label-sm"
>
企业名称
</label>
<div
class=
"col-sm-6"
>
<input
type=
"text"
class=
"form-control"
id=
"companyName
"
required=
"required"
>
<input
type=
"text"
class=
"form-control"
id=
"companyName"
placeholder=
"企业名称"
aria-label=
"企业名称
"
required=
"required"
>
</div>
</div>
<div
class=
"form-group row"
>
<label
for=
"loginPrefix"
class=
"col-sm-2 col-form-label col-form-label-sm"
>
登录前缀
</label>
<div
class=
"col-sm-6"
>
<input
type=
"text"
class=
"form-control"
id=
"loginPrefix
"
>
<input
type=
"text"
class=
"form-control"
id=
"loginPrefix"
placeholder=
"登录前缀"
aria-label=
"登录前缀
"
>
</div>
</div>
<div
class=
"form-group row"
>
...
...
@@ -62,7 +62,9 @@
<label
for=
"docIdPc"
class=
"col-sm-2 col-form-label"
>
PC端log
</label>
<div
class=
"col-sm-6"
>
<EF:EFUpload
ename=
"docIdPc"
cname=
"PC上传"
docTag=
"hk_filePc"
path=
"A"
/>
<
%
--
<
input
type=
"file"
class=
"form-control"
id=
"docIdPc"
>
--%>
<div
class=
"side-header"
id=
"pc-img"
style=
"background-color: whitesmoke"
>
<img
src=
"${ctx}/hpjx-logo.png"
style=
"width:200px;height:55px;background-image: none;"
alt=
"pc端log"
/>
</div>
</div>
<input
type=
"hidden"
id=
"PCfileDocId"
value=
""
>
</div>
...
...
@@ -70,21 +72,23 @@
<label
for=
"docIdApp"
class=
"col-sm-2 col-form-label"
>
APP端log
</label>
<div
class=
"col-sm-6"
>
<EF:EFUpload
ename=
"docIdApp"
cname=
"APP上传"
docTag=
"hk_fileApp"
path=
"A"
/>
<
%
--
<
input
type=
"file"
class=
"form-control"
accept=
"image/*"
id=
"docIdApp"
>
--%>
<div
class=
"side-header"
id=
"app-img"
style=
"background-color: whitesmoke"
>
<img
src=
"${ctx}/hpjx-logo.png"
style=
"width:200px;height:55px;background-image: none;"
alt=
"app端log"
/>
</div>
</div>
<input
type=
"hidden"
id=
"APPfileDocId"
value=
""
>
</div>
<div
class=
"form-group row"
>
<label
for=
"remark"
class=
"col-sm-2 col-form-label col-form-label-sm"
>
备注
</label>
<div
class=
"col-sm-6"
>
<input
type=
"text"
class=
"form-control"
id=
"remark"
>
<textarea
id=
"remark"
class=
"form-control"
placeholder=
"备注"
aria-label=
"备注"
></textarea
>
</div>
</div>
<input
type=
"hidden"
id=
"type"
value=
"insert"
>
<input
type=
"hidden"
id=
"id"
value=
""
>
<input
type=
"hidden"
id=
"companyCode"
value=
""
>
<div
class=
"form-group col-md-6 col-sm-6 col-sm-offset-9"
>
<button
type=
"button"
onclick=
"save()"
class=
"btn btn-info
"
>
确认
</button>
<button
type=
"button"
onclick=
"save()"
class=
"btn btn-primary
"
>
确认
</button>
</div>
</form>
</EF:EFWindow>
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ment